Rewrite this Page?[edit]
With regards to #Feedback 2022/09/22, #Mounts and the new Template {{Teleportation devices nav}} I think this page seriously needs a rewrite. I'm willing to help, but I don't know where to start and I think some discussion about it would be beneficial.
Issues I see with this page:
- Title is somewhat unclear: what is the intent of this page?
- Is this page intended for in-map or inter-map travel and navigation?
- If these should be separated what names would be fitting for the new pages? I.e. what would your search query look like?
- The Teleportation devices table has one section about Portal devices. These function fundamentally different from the other items in this table, should they still be included in the table of should they be moved to a new section?
Sections that I think should be included for in-map navigation:
- Travel nodes (Waypoints, shrines, etc.)
- Personal Jadebot Waypoint
- Mounts
- Mount rentals
- Portal devices (Watchwork, White Mantel, Prototype Position Rewinder)
Sections that I think should be included for inter-map navigation
- Lounge passes
- Lounge passes navigation {{Lounge passes nav}}
- Portal scrolls
- Portal scroll navigation {{Teleportation devices nav}}
- Asura gates and Reducing Travel Cost
- Gem store items (list would be better than text, wouldn't it?)
